Important differences between star anise and pound cake

  • Star anise has more iron, copper, manganese, calcium, fiber, vitamin B6, zinc, phosphorus, magnesium, and potassium than pound cake.
  • Star anise's daily need coverage for iron is 444% more.
  • Star anise contains 24 times more fiber than pound cake. Star anise contains 14.6g of fiber, while pound cake contains 0.6g.
  • Star anise has a higher glycemic index. The glycemic index of star anise is 89, while the glycemic index of pound cake is 54.

The food varieties used in the comparison are Spices, anise seed and Cake, pound, commercially prepared, butter (includes fresh and frozen).
